It aids firms in spotting, controlling, and eliminating the many ways money inadvertently drains from their processes. What is Financial Leakage? Lack of defined procedures, uncompleted tasks, errors, outdated techniques, and simple lack of supervision all contribute towards a system's unintentional loss of funds (financial leakage).
